3. Treats Canker Sores

Canker sores, though small, can be extremely painful. These tiny round ulcers form inside the mouth rather than on the lips. They don’t spread and often appear after consuming too many fatty foods. While canker sores usually heal by themselves, the pain can be significant. Use the baking soda mouthwash mentioned in #2—one to two teaspoons of baking soda diluted in half a glass of water—daily if you have a canker sore. Studies show this can significantly reduce pain and aid in the healing process.
